Saint Nathanael the Apostle

Saint Nathanael (Simon the Zealot or Bartholomew – son of Pholomew) came from Cana of Galilee where the Lord performed his first miracle. He was a close friend of the Apostle Philip, who announced to him the fulfillment of the prophecy in the Person of Jesus Christ.

Then he became one of the 12 Apostles for whom the Lord praised, saying: “Behold, a true Israelite, there is none of them”. The apostolic activity of the Apostle Nathanael extends to Africa, Mauritania and Britain, where he was crucified by pagans.

Saint Theodore the Syceotis, bishop of Anastasiapolis

Saint Theodore of Syceotis lived at the end of the 6th and the beginning of the 7th century. He came from the village of Sykeoi in Galatia, Asia Minor, from which he took the nickname “Sykeotis”.

His mother Maria was a former prostitute who dedicated herself to raising her child. His father’s name was Cosmas and he was a royal postman. But Kosmas abandoned the pregnant Maria.

Theodore became a monk at the Hotzeva Monastery in Palestine and he became a monk in various monasteries both in Palestine and in the Christian East. He was even called by the Emperor and the Patriarch to the City to bless and preach. But because his fame was growing and he did not want to be honored, he returned to his monastery. He also served as bishop of Anastasiapolis.

Saint Theodore slept in peace in the year 613 AD.
